A Conversation with Malcolm T.
What is your “Why” at PPL?
My Why started before I ever became an employee at PPL.
Several years ago, I was laid off from an AT&T subdivision called ACC Business when my role was outsourced overseas. After four years of service, that was a tough moment. I remember buying a laptop and naming it Endeavor because I needed a reminder that failure wasn’t an option. I was determined to keep moving forward.
That same mindset is what I bring to PPL every day.
Every interaction I’ve had, the people I’ve worked with throughout my journey here have helped shaped who I am, and it’s been an honor to work with so many great people.
What keeps me motivated most is knowing that our work truly impacts people’s lives.
Is there an experience that stands out during your time at PPL?
Yes. In the early days of the April 2025 transition, a consumer was caught in a frustrating cycle, being sent back and forth between her Managed Care Organization (MCO) and PPL because of an issue with her service authorization. After digging into the situation, I discovered the problem was tied to paperwork that had been mishandled internally by the MCO.
For several days, I worked alongside that consumer & the MCO, documenting every interaction to get everything resolved. In the end, we secured her service authorization and helped recover back pay owed to her personal assistant dating back to March 2025.
That experience reminded me why I do this work. It wasn’t about solving the paperwork issue. It was about making sure someone felt heard and had an advocate in their corner when they needed one the most.
Today, I come to work each day with the same determination.
My Why is simple: helping people, solving problems, and making a difference for the consumers and personal assistants who count on us.
